Major Howard County, Arkansas Real Estate Markets

Nashville serves as the county seat and primary real estate hub, offering the most diverse inventory ranging from historic downtown properties to newer suburban developments. The city's role as a regional center for healthcare and education creates steady demand for both residential and commercial real estate. Dierks represents another significant market area, particularly known for its proximity to recreational opportunities around Dierks Lake, which drives seasonal property interest and vacation home sales.

The broader Southwest Arkansas region influences Howard County's market dynamics, with spillover effects from larger metropolitan areas creating pockets of increased activity. Rural properties throughout the county attract buyers seeking agricultural land, hunting properties, and those looking to escape urban environments. This geographic diversity means agents must understand everything from farmland valuations to lakefront property assessments.

Market Dynamics and Geographic Complexity

Howard County's real estate market exhibits seasonal fluctuations tied to both agricultural cycles and recreational property demand. Spring and summer months typically see increased activity, particularly for properties near water features or those suitable for outdoor recreation. The market's relatively small size means that individual transactions can significantly impact overall statistics, creating both opportunities and challenges for market analysis.

Geographic complexity arises from the county's varied terrain, which includes forested areas, agricultural land, and developed communities. Property types range from century-old farmhouses to modern lake homes, requiring agents to possess broad expertise.
